Dallas Stars More news is coming on why the Stars did not trade away Mike Ribeiro for a top defenseman. As mentioned in my article yesterday, the Stars are having budget problems and to trade him required taking salary back since Ribeiro has a five million dollar cap hit. Stars, D Grossman agree on 2-year, $3.25M deal
DALLAS (AP) The Dallas Stars have agreed to terms with defenseman Nicklas Grossman on a two-year contract worth $3.25 million. The 25-year-old Grossman skated in 71 games for the Stars last season, finishing with seven assists and 32 penalty minutes.
